
Hand Of JusticeTFT Item Stats
While above 50% health, double the Attack Damage and Ability Power. While below 50% Health, double the Omnivamp.

How do you build Hand Of Justice in TFT?
To build Hand Of Justice in TFT Set 16, combine Tear of the Goddess and Sparring Gloves on the same champion. You can get these component items from carousel rounds, PvE drops, or item orbs. Once both components are equipped on a champion, they automatically combine into Hand Of Justice.
